In Kogi State, the health sector has witnessed a significant transformation under successive administrations, but under the leadership of Governor Ahmed Usman Ododo, notable improvement in health care infrastructure, service delivery and policies have been recorded.


Before Governor Ododo's assumption of office, the State faced major health challenges, including inadequate health care facilities with almost non functional Primary Health Care Centres (PHC).


Also, the State had experienced poor remuneration for health workers, lack of essential medical equipment and supplies, inadequate manpower, especially in rural areas, inadequate drug supplies, making it difficult for patients to access necessary medication.


These Challenges no doubt have hindered the State from meeting global standards due to inadequate monitoring and evaluation of health care workers. 


One major challenge affecting the State Health sector before now is implementation of seventy percent of the health budget in urban areas where only thirty percent of the population resides.


These challenges necessitated the need for improved health care infrastructure, increased access to quality health care services and better health outcomes for the people of kogi state.


The Initiatives of Governor Ahmed Usman Ododo have significantly improved health care outcomes in Kogi State in the last two years.


This is because the Governor took some practical steps which include the revitalisation of eighty Primary Health Care centres across the twenty one Local Government Areas which obviously, has enhanced access to quality health care especially in rural communities, providing twenty four hour health care services. 


Consequently, the measure has improved maternal and infant health and increased access to health care across board, not leaving or ignoring any segment of the population.


The State in its bid to addressing the manpower shortage in the health sector, supported Prince Abubakar Audu University Anyigba for its MBBS program and the Confluence University of Science and Technology Osara.


The Ododo led administration has in the last two years unveiled quality health care services for the people, through the Kogi State Health Insurance Scheme initiated by his predecessor, former Governor Yahaya Bello's administration.


With the Agency, thousands of orphans, Civil Servants at the State and Local Government levels, pensioners, students of State owned Tertiary Institutions and Ex Service Men have been enrolled in the State Health Insurance programme.


It is equally worthy to note that Governor Ododo's administration recently implemented a three hundred thousand naira allowance for medical Doctors in the payroll of the State Government and as well, plan to build Doctors quarters in strategic locations.


His administration has also sustained partnership with Development Organisations like world Health Organisation, WHO, UNICEF and the Federal Ministry of Health among others, all in a bid to improve health care delivery.


Also, under the present administration, the one hundred percent implementation of hazard allowance for Doctors and other health workers in Kogi State, an achievement which seemed to be impossible for years was made possible through the Governor's political will, sincerity of purpose and commitment to genuine course in governance.
